Technical Description

This vertical machining center features a 5-axis configuration with X, Y, and Z travels of 15.7", 8.7", and 13.8" respectively, and full rotational capabilities on A (360°) and B (110°) axes. Its worktable measures 5.9" by 9.8" and supports a maximum workpiece weight of 22 lbs, suited for compact precision machining. The spindle is vertical with an HSK E32 taper, delivering up to 40,000 RPM with 11 HP power (30-minute rating), capable of high-speed micromachining applications. The machine employs a double arm gripper tool carrier system accommodating 80 tools, facilitating rapid tool changes in 3 seconds. Maximum feed and rapid traverse rates on linear axes reach 866 inches per minute, providing efficient and precise material removal. The high-speed spindle taper HSK E32 ensures high rigidity and accuracy, compatible with precision tool holders and supporting demanding milling, drilling, and grinding operations.
